SSA HR Reporting Sr. Analyst
Position Summary The SSA HR Reporting Sr. Analyst supports the delivery of accurate, timely, and compliant HR reporting by partnering with HR stakeholders to produce operational, regulatory, and analytical reports. This role is responsible for maintaining reporting standards, ensuring data integrity, and supporting data-driven decision-making across the organization. Serving as a key contributor within Shared Services Administration (SSA), the SSA HR Reporting Sr. Analyst works closely with SSA, SSA HR Technology, IT, and functional HR teams to improve reporting processes, support system integrations, and respond to routine and ad hoc reporting needs. This role requ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to translate data into meaningful insights while maintaining confidentiality and compliance. Key Responsibilities HR Reporting & Analytics (Approximately 70%) Develop, maintain, and deliver standard and ad hoc HR reports, dashboards, and metrics. Gather and analyze HR data to support workforce planning, compliance, audits, and leadership reporting. Ensure accuracy, consistency, and integrity of HR data across reporting outputs. Maintain documentation for HR reporting processes, definitions, and controls. Support government and regulatory reporting requirements (e.g., EEO, audits, compliance submissions). Respond to routine and complex HR data requests while adhering to data privacy and confidentiality standards. Systems, Process Improvement & Team Support (Approximately 30%) Partner with SSA HR Technology, IT, and vendors to support reporting enhancements, system integrations, and upgrades. Participate in system testing, data validation, and user acceptance testing for HR systems. Identify opportunities to improve reporting efficiency, automation, and data quality. Support change management efforts related to new tools, reports, or HR reporting standards. Provide input and recommendations to HR leadership to support continuous improvement initiatives.
